Tricia Richardson

Legal Assistant at American Family Association

Tricia Richardson has extensive experience in administrative support roles, currently serving as a Legal Assistant at the American Family Association since February 1995. Prior to this position, Tricia worked as a Secretary to the Registrar at Berry College from January 1989 to January 1990 and as a Secretary to the Chair of the Political Science Department at the University of Mississippi from June 1986 to May 1987. Tricia holds a Bachelor of Science in Paralegal Studies from Mississippi University for Women (1993-1994) and an Associate of Arts from Itawamba Community College (1991-1993).

American Family Association

The mission of American Family Association is to inform, equip, and activate individuals and families to transform American culture and to give aid to the church, here and abroad, in its calling to fulfill the Great Commission. The American Family Association believes that God has communicated absolute truth to mankind, and that all people are subject to the authority of God’s Word at all times. Therefore AFA believes that a culture based on biblical truth best serves the well-being of our nation and our families, in accordance with the vision of our founding documents; and that personal transformation through the Gospel of Jesus Christ is the greatest agent of biblical change in any culture.
